Finally got around to finishing the demo. Not bad at all, although I'm not sure I like the new camera system. I really don't like how Lara turns around when you press the back button, so to see what's in front of her, you have to turn the camera around too. Besides, I just want to see Lara doing back and side flips, which look way much cooler anyway. Unfortunately, I couldn't make her do any of those flips in this demo. Is there a way? I hope they didn't remove them from her repertoire of moves.
In any case, I think I still prefer the old camera system that sticks to the back of Lara. I've always thought that the TR camera was the best of its kind (for example, I wish MGS had TR's camera), even though it could get problematic in tight places.
